Asialoglycoprotein receptor 2 (also abbreviated as ASGPR2),a subunit of the Asialoglycoprotein receptor (ASGPR), is a protein encoding by a gene named Asgr2 in mouse and a gene named ASGR2 in human. Asialoglycoprotein receptor (ASGPR) is a receptor specifically expressed by hepatocytes, and it is a highly efficient endocytic receptor. The main function of ASGPR is to remove asialoglycoprotein, apoptotic cells and lipoproteins in the blood circulation system. In addition to asialoceruloplasmin, ASGPR can also bind to many other asialoglycoproteins, such as erythropoietin, interferon, thyroglobulin, transferrin, hepatoglobulin, fetuin, prothrombin and so on.

Target Background

Function
Mediates the endocytosis of plasma glycoproteins to which the terminal sialic acid residue on their complex carbohydrate moieties has been removed. The receptor recognizes terminal galactose and N-acetylgalactosamine units. After ligand binding to the receptor, the resulting complex is internalized and transported to a sorting organelle, where receptor and ligand are disassociated. The receptor then returns to the cell membrane surface.
Gene References into Functions
  1. ASGP-R2 mediates the clearance of glycoproteins that bear oligosaccharides terminating with Siaalpha2,6Gal and thereby helps maintain the relative concentrations of these glycoproteins in the blood. PMID: 19075021
Subcellular Location
Membrane; Single-pass type II membrane protein.
Tissue Specificity
Expressed exclusively in hepatic parenchymal cells.
